520 | |a The problem of this study is how the major character, Philip Carey actualizes himself in William Somerset Maugham's Of Human Bondage. The objective of this study is to analize William Somerset Maugham's Of Human Bondage based on the structural element and Maslow's humanistic psychological approach. This study belongs to qualitative research. In this method, there are two types data sources which are used, namely primary and secondary data sources. The primary data source is the novel itself. The secondary data source is taken from books and other sources which support the analysis. The method of data collection is library research and tecnique of data collection is descriptive technique. Having analyzed the novel, the writer draws that Plilip Carey, the major character of the novel can actualize himself although he is cripple. It can be known from his life that he can pass the four basic needs (Physiological needs, Safety needs, Love and Belongingness needs, Self esteem needs) and has the fifteen characteristics of Selfactualization. | ||
